Climate summary

South Bay has an annual average temperature of 74.3°F with about 55.2 inches of precipitation per year. The warmest month is July (average high 92.3°F), and the coldest is January (average low 51.8°F). June is typically the wettest month (9.49 in) and February the driest (1.90 in).

Monthly averages

Month Avg High Avg Low Avg Temp Precipitation Snow Rainy days
January 75.9°F 51.8°F 63.9°F 2.27 in 9
February 78.7°F 53.1°F 65.9°F 1.90 in 7
March 81.7°F 56.9°F 69.3°F 3.03 in 8
April 86.0°F 60.5°F 73.2°F 2.14 in 8
May 89.2°F 65.9°F 77.5°F 4.55 in 9
June 91.1°F 70.7°F 80.9°F 9.49 in 16
July 92.3°F 72.4°F 82.4°F 7.01 in 17
August 92.3°F 72.7°F 82.5°F 8.63 in 17
September 90.8°F 72.0°F 81.4°F 7.29 in 18
October 87.3°F 67.3°F 77.3°F 4.26 in 12
November 81.4°F 60.1°F 70.8°F 2.55 in 8
December 77.9°F 55.6°F 66.7°F 2.10 in 8
